If you are both listed as joint tenants on the property title deed then this means you both own the property fully together. So removing one person from the deed would definitely require their agreement and you should probably speak to a conveyancer to make sure you approach everything legally and fairly. Removing a name from a property title can have many far-reaching legal, financial and taxation consequences, so seek professional advice tailored to your situation. If you’re unable to collect your prescription medication because you’re self-isolating, a free medicines delivery service is available. First, you should ask if any friends, family or volunteers can collect medicines for you. This is because, if you have been infected, you could be infectious to others.

A face visor or shield may be worn in addition to a face covering but we do not recommend that they are worn instead of one. This is because face visors or shields do not cover the nose and mouth, and do not filter airborne particles. If you wish to use an exemption card or badge, you can download exemption card templates.
